The inhibitory effect of some isoxazolpyrimidine derivatives on iNOS and CO
X-2 endotoxin induction in mouse peritoneal macrophages has been studied. T
hree of these compounds inhibited nitrite and PGE(2) accumulation in a conc
entration dependent-manner at mu M range. None of these active compounds af
fected iNOS, COX-2, COX-1 or PLA(2) activities, although some reduced iNOS
or COX-2 expression. Besides, no effect was observed on human neutrophil in
flammatory responses (LTB4 biosynthesis and superoxide or elastase release)
. Active compounds were assayed by oral administration in the mouse air pou
ch model, where they inhibited nitrite accumulation without affecting PGE2
levels or leukocyte migration. (C) 2000 Elsevier Science Inc.
